Nothing wrong with 16" of wheel travel IFS 4x4!!
On our road my BII is the quickest truck in and out....so smooth on the bumps and holes our "driveway" has to offer...... The Fj cruiser is next in line with its IFS and coil spring rear suspension, also very smooth, can get in and out quickly
the solid axle trucks Excursion and F350 are SLOW in and out on this road. In the summer the 2wd van is smoooth like glass too, it has leaf sprung rear axle and 2wd equal length front TTB beams.......
IFS + daily driver = easier on you, just not easy on the wallet
